With 88,434 degrees handed out in 2020-2021, computer information systems is the 9th most popular major in the United States. In 2019-2020, computer information systems gra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$54,066 and had an average of $26,787 in loans still to pay off.
Across Michigan, there were 2,440 computer information systems graduates with average earnings and debt of $62,679 and $27,444 respectively. At the doctor’s degree level specifically, there were 40 computer information systems graduates with average earnings and debt of $71,142 and $0 respectively.

Out of the 4 schools in the Most Well Attended CIS Major in Michigan for a Doctorate that were part of this year’s ranking, Michigan State University landed the #1 spot on the list. Michigan State University is a large school located in East Lansing, Michigan that handed out 17 doctorate’s CIS degrees in 2020-2021.
With a freshman retention rate of 91%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its undergraduate students. The low undergrad student loan default rate of 2.6%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Oakland University. It ranked #2 on our 2023 Most Well Attended CIS Major in Michigan for a Doctorate list. Oakland is a public institution located in Rochester Hills, Michigan. The school has a fairly large population, and it awarded 11 doctorate’s degrees in 2020-2021.
The low undergrad student loan default rate of 3.6%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.

Out of the 4 schools in the Most Well Attended CIS Major in Michigan for a Doctorate that were part of this year’s ranking, Wayne State University landed the #2 spot on the list. Wayne State University is a public institution located in Detroit, Michigan. The school has a large population, and it awarded 11 doctorate’s degrees in 2020-2021.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Michigan - Dearborn. It ranked #4 on our 2023 Most Well Attended CIS Major in Michigan for a Doctorate list. University of Michigan - Dearborn is a medium-sized public school situated in Dearborn, Michigan. It awarded 1 doctorate’s CIS degrees in 2020-2021.
The undergrad student loan default rate at the school is 3.7%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.
